FD Chief Involved In Crash On Way To Fire In Rockland

A Spring Valley fire chief involved in a vehicle crash en route to a fire is said to be doing fine.

The crash occurred around 5:07 p.m. Friday when Chief Raymond Canario, 41, was on his way to a fire when he struck another vehicle, police said.

The chief was traveling southbound on Route 306 when he collided with a 2016 Toyota being driven by a 52-year-old Spring Valley resident, said Ramapo Police.

The Toyota was also traveling south on Route 306 and was attempting to turn left onto Ralph Boulevard.  After striking the Toyota the chief’s command vehicle struck a telephone pole before going down an embankment, Ramapo police said.

Canario was transported to Good Samaritan Hospital by Spring Hill Ambulance with head and shoulder pain. The other driver was not injured. 

The Monsey Fire Department also responded to the scene. 

No tickets were issued and the accident remains under investigation.
